PPS Resin Sales Market Outlook

The global PPS resin market is projected to reach approximately USD 1.5 billion by 2035, growing at a compound annual growth rate (CAGR) of around 6.0% during the forecast period from 2025 to 2035. The growth of the PPS resin market can be attributed to the increasing demand for high-performance and lightweight materials across various industries, particularly in the automotive and electronics sectors. Notably, the rising trend towards sustainable and eco-friendly products is also contributing to the market growth, as PPS resins are known for their recyclability and durability. Furthermore, the advancement in processing technologies for PPS resins is leading to enhanced performance characteristics, making them more attractive to manufacturers. Additionally, growing industrial applications and the shift towards energy-efficient alternatives present significant opportunities for the market.

By Product Type

Linear PPS Resin:

Linear PPS resin is a prominent segment in the PPS resin market, characterized by its excellent thermal stability, mechanical strength, and chemical resistance. This type of resin is widely utilized in applications that require stringent performance standards, such as automotive parts, electrical components, and industrial machinery. Its linear structure allows for easy processing and molding, making it a preferred choice for manufacturers looking for versatile materials that can withstand harsh environments. Additionally, the demand for linear PPS resin is expected to grow as manufacturers seek lightweight alternatives to traditional thermoplastics, thus contributing to the overall market growth.

Cross-linked PPS Resin:

Cross-linked PPS resin offers a unique combination of properties, including enhanced chemical resistance and dimensional stability, which make it suitable for high-performance applications. This type of resin is often used in environments that endure extreme temperatures and aggressive chemicals, such as aerospace and military applications. The cross-linking process improves the mechanical properties and thermal stability, leading to increased demand in specialized sectors that require durable components. As industries continue to prioritize reliability and performance, the cross-linked PPS resin segment is poised for significant growth in the coming years.

Branched PPS Resin:

Branched PPS resin is notable for its improved flow characteristics and processability compared to its linear counterparts. This segment is particularly advantageous for applications that require complex geometries and intricate designs, such as automotive and consumer electronics. The branched structure results in lower viscosity during processing, allowing for easier injection molding and shaping. As manufacturers increasingly focus on innovative designs and lightweight solutions, the branched PPS resin segment is expected to gain traction, contributing further to market expansion.

By Application

Automotive:

The automotive application segment is among the largest consumers of PPS resins, owing to the industry's continuous push for lightweight materials that enhance fuel efficiency and performance. PPS resins are utilized in manufacturing various automotive components, including fuel systems, electrical connectors, and structural parts, due to their exceptional heat resistance and mechanical strength. Furthermore, as electric vehicles gain popularity, the demand for PPS resins is expected to rise, as manufacturers seek materials that can withstand the unique challenges presented by electrification and battery technologies. This increasing adoption of PPS resins in the automotive sector is anticipated to drive significant market growth.

Electrical & Electronics:

PPS resins play a crucial role in the electrical and electronics industry, where their high dielectric strength and thermal stability make them suitable for a wide range of applications. They are commonly used in insulators, connectors, and circuit boards, where reliability is paramount. As the demand for smaller, more efficient electronic devices grows, the need for lightweight and high-performance materials like PPS resins also increases. This ongoing trend is expected to propel the electrical and electronics application segment, further solidifying the market position of PPS resins in these sectors.

By Ingredient Type

Glass Fiber Reinforced PPS Resin:

Glass fiber reinforced PPS resin is known for its enhanced mechanical strength and dimensional stability, making it a preferred choice in applications requiring durability and performance. This type of resin is commonly used in automotive and industrial components, where strength and weight reduction are critical. The reinforcement provided by glass fibers allows for greater load-bearing capacity and resistance to deformation under stress. As industries increasingly prioritize high-performance materials, the demand for glass fiber reinforced PPS resin is expected to rise, further contributing to the overall growth of the market.

Carbon Fiber Reinforced PPS Resin:

Carbon fiber reinforced PPS resin is recognized for its exceptional strength-to-weight ratio and lightweight properties, making it ideal for high-performance applications. This type of resin is often used in aerospace, automotive, and sports equipment manufacturing, where reducing weight without compromising structural integrity is essential. The increasing emphasis on fuel efficiency and performance in various industries is expected to drive the demand for carbon fiber reinforced PPS resin. As manufacturers continue to innovate and seek advanced materials, this segment will play a crucial role in the overall growth of the PPS resin market.

Mineral Filled PPS Resin:

Mineral filled PPS resin is often utilized in applications requiring enhanced dimensional stability and lower thermal expansion. The inclusion of mineral fillers improves the overall performance of the resin, making it suitable for various industrial and automotive applications. As industries seek to optimize material performance and minimize costs, the demand for mineral filled PPS resin is projected to increase. This trend reflects the broader market movement towards materials that offer both performance and economic benefits, contributing positively to the growth of this segment.

Threats

Despite the robust growth prospects, the PPS resin market faces several potential threats that could hinder its expansion. One significant challenge is the volatility of raw material prices, which can impact production costs and margins for manufacturers. Fluctuations in the prices of petrochemicals, from which PPS resins are derived, can lead to unpredictability in market dynamics. Furthermore, as manufacturers strive to keep production costs competitive, sudden increases in raw material costs could affect pricing strategies and the overall profitability of PPS resin products. Companies will need to implement effective risk management strategies to mitigate the impact of such fluctuations on their operations.

Another considerable threat to the market is the growing competition from alternative materials, particularly bioplastics and other engineered thermoplastics that offer similar performance characteristics. As industries seek to adopt more sustainable practices, the demand for eco-friendly materials could divert attention away from traditional PPS resins. Companies must adapt to this changing landscape by innovating and highlighting the unique benefits of PPS resins, such as their long-term durability and performance under extreme conditions. Failure to keep pace with evolving consumer preferences and competitive pressures could lead to a decline in market share for traditional PPS resin manufacturers.
